
The rolling prairie of the Columbia County and Dane County border defines this 2022 survey, centered on the village of Arlington. The landscape reflects a deeply established agricultural heritage, evidenced by numerous historic burial grounds including Arlington Prairie Cem and the uniquely named One Hundred Mile Grove Cem. The village of Dane anchors the southwestern corner, connected to its neighbors by a geometric grid of rural roads like Smokey Hollow Rd and Pine Hollow Rd. This modern map maintains the precise locations of small rural landmarks like the Eberle Ranch Airport and the Arlington Evangelical Cem, providing contemporary spatial context for local historians tracing family names and property boundaries in this transition zone between two major Wisconsin counties.
